Silvano's Pizza & Mini Mart

197 W Church St, Seymour, CT 06483
Silvano's Pizza & Mini Mart Silvano's Pizza & Mini Mart is one of the popular Restaurant located in 197 W Church St ,Seymour listed under Restaurant in Seymour ,

Contact Details & Working Hours

Map of Silvano's Pizza & Mini Mart